Find centralized, trusted content and collaborate around the technologies you use most.
Teams
Q&A for work
Connect and share knowledge within a single location that is structured and easy to search.
我有一个带有自定义图形的 QGraphicsItem,如下图的上半部分所示,其中红色圆圈是shape()该项目的:
shape()
有没有办法保留图形,但只是像下半部分所示的那样移动它?
我不认为,你可以移动没有形状的 QGraphicsItem。形状绑定到 QGraphicsItem。它根据 QGraphicsItem 改变它的坐标。
如果你想实现像你的图的后半部分一样的东西。你需要有两个 QGraphicsItems(一个是你的红色外圈,第二个是你的内部图形项)。